DEGREES OFFERED

Bachelor of Arts in Music (Major)

Bachelor of Arts in Music (Music Education Emphasis)

Bachelor of Arts in Music (Performance Emphasis)


Whether you're interested in performance, teaching, or a broad exposure to the world of music, you'll find your home here. We emphasize self-expression, creativity, and excellence in all disciplines, at all levels. Music major information. Join an ensemble. Play in the British Eighth Marching Band. Take private lessons. And study off campus somewhere in the U.S. or abroad. We're regulars at regional and national workshops—and you can be, too. Music experience opportunities. Professional performance. Graduate school. Teaching. Arts and music management. The confidence you build here through close mentoring relationships and competitive opportunities will make the difference you need to succeed in any number of fields.

Otherworld Theatre Company's board of directors announced today that it has named Katie Ruppert as the company's new Managing Director. Ruppert will assume her new position at Otherworld in addition to being the Sketch and Improv Curator, on May 6, 2019, replacing founding Managing Director, Mary-Kate Arnold. Arnold will move to a new dual-role within the company as Associate Artistic Director and Casting Director. Otherworld is committed to developing productions and acts which match their mission to bring a live experience to the Science Fiction and Fantasy genres. Otherworld is the world's first and only live performance venue dedicated to the production of Science Fiction and Fantasy works.

Following a nationwide search, the Sharon Lynne Wilson Center for the Arts (Wilson Center) has named Anna M. Thompson as its Executive Director. Thompson comes to the Wilson Center from the Alys Stephens Performing Arts Center at the University of Alabama at Birmingham (UAB), where she served for two-and-a-half years as the Associate Vice President and Executive Director, overseeing a $4.8 million budget and producing and presenting more than 700 performances, residencies, and events annually.
